Secret Beach on the Oregon coast is a hidden paradise that offers serenity and beauty. Tucked away in Brookings, Secret Beach is only accessible at low tide and requires a bit of rock scrambling when approaching it from the trail. It's worth the effort though - visitors here can expect stunning ocean views, plenty of driftwood, sea stacks dotted with trees, and an array of coves and caves to explore. Not to mention the remarkable wildlife - whales, puffins, bald eagles, seals, and sea lions are just some of the many animals that can be found.
